The diagram shows one step in the process of protein synthesis. mc015-1.jpg What is the purpose of the peptide bond that is show
Alenkinab [10]

The right answer is It connects amino acids.

• Amino acids are the building blocks of proteins.

• There are 21 amino acids, but only one type of binding used to connect them: it is the peptide bond.

The peptide bond is formed during the translation step by a covalent bond between an α-amino group of an amino acid and the carboxylic group of another amino acid. A molecule of water is eliminated.
